How Big Is 2 Nanometers. There are about 20 atoms along this line, so one nanometer is about the width of 2 silicon atoms, and the gate length of a 20nm nand flash. One nanometer is about as long as your fingernail grows in one second. A nanometer (nm) is a measurement 1,000 times smaller than a micrometer and equates to 1/1,000,000,000th of a meter. • a strand of human dna is 2.5 nanometers in diameter.
